Really think people are going mental over nothing.

Play the ball to his feet. Play some through balls. Don't hoof it to him.

We did all right with that approach from January-May, so I'm not sure why we're so reluctant now. Without Fellaini in the team the aerial approach is just criminal. Jelavic isn't Fellaini -- he won't pick a 60 yard ball out of the air and turn it into a chance.

But Fellaini isn't Jelavic. He won't make a superb, defensive-splitting run and stroke the ball into the net with the finesse of a master painter.

I think with Mirallas or Osman behind Jelavic and Felli playing a box-to-box role Jelavic would bang a lot more in. Ultimately though a lone striker lives and dies by his midfield. Not just creativity-wise, but without support he becomes isolated. We got men up to support him with all the promptness of an iceberg yesterday. Regularly I'd see 5 or 6 Norwich players get back to defend before 1 or 2 other blue shirts arrived.
